Homer police have arrested a Texas man following a string of break-ins and thefts.

Officers say multiple incidents occurred on Monday, starting with a home on Kachemak Drive being broken into while the residents were away. Later reports included a man shining lights into a home in the Soundview area and another person found inside a vehicle on Tajen and Eric Lane.

Around 4 a.m., police responded to a business alarm on the Homer Spit and discovered the suspected vehicle used in the crimes. The truck was seized, and 26-year-old John Austin Mixon of Katy, Texas, was arrested after being identified through security cameras.
